*tip with the heels (I guess when dealing with Patent leather...if it's too tight on your toes, put on thick sock, and use hair dryer to heat up the patent leather and then stick foot in to stretch it out. Obviously don't heat it too much to damage the shoe. It took maybe 5 minutes of repeating this for the heel to fit around my toes correctly).
